Ingredients
- 2 tablespoons white sugar
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 4 teaspoons honey
- 1 tablespoon cider vinegar
- 1 teaspoon lemon juice
- 2 cups torn salad greens
- 1 avocado - peeled , pitted and sliced
- 10 strawberries , sliced
- 0.5 cups chopped pecans
Instructions
-
1
In a small bowl, whisk together the sugar, olive oil, honey, vinegar, and lemon juice. Set aside.
-
2
Place the salad greens in a pretty bowl, and top with sliced avocado and strawberries. Drizzle dressing over everything, then sprinkle with pecans. Refrigerate for up to 2 hours before serving, or serve immediately.
